The Realities of Selling on Amazon: A Practical Guide for Founders

eCommerceFuel

Selling on Amazon comes with its costs and difficulties, but also massive potential. According to the State of the Amazon Seller 2023 report , 89% of Amazon sellers are profitable, and 37% reported increased profits in 2022 despite rising costs. Additionally, there may be additional advertising costs. So, is it worth it?
